Emergence of Ekrem Imamoglu as a Challenger to Tayyip Erdogan

Newly re-elected Istanbul Mayor Ekrem Imamoglu emerges as the main challenger to Turkish President Tayyip Erdogan's reign, celebrating victory with a message to Erdogan and officials. Both have strong voter appeal and family roots in the Black Sea region, but Imamoglu is from the secular CHP party, while Erdogan reshaped Turkey with an Islamist vision. Erdogan's critics cite eroding civil rights and press freedoms, while Imamoglu faces judicial challenges. Imamoglu's success lies in winning over conservative voters.
